Subiaco’s European-inspired food and drink festival, Subi Spritz, is returning this March with four days of events spread across the precinct.

Running from March 26 to March 29, the festival will feature more than 20 events, mixing long lunches, wine tastings, aperitivo sessions and hands-on workshops. Popular fixtures like the Conti Roll Contest are back, alongside a Subi Night Market x Subi Spritz collaboration and a stack of new additions to the program.

Events, tastings and more

The opening night on Thursday sets the tone with An Italian Crafted Pairing Journey at Intuition Wine & Kitchen, where a five-course Italian and French-inspired menu will be paired with curated wines. The same night also sees the return of the Conti Roll Contest, pitting Perth sandwich stores against each other, and Lum’s Wine Battle Vol. 4, a guided tasting of European wines with Italian grazing boards hosted by Lum’s, Flowstone and Somos.

Workshops are again a key part of the program. La Delizia Latticini will host its Burrata Masterclass at Bar Amelie, combining a live burrata demonstration with a burrata bar and free-flowing Howard Park wines.

Little Things Distilling Co will run a Limoncello Masterclass, showing guests how to create a limoncello base and personalise it with infused syrups.

Wine events include the Howard Park Wines Riesling & Cabernet Masterclass, marking the winery’s 40th anniversary, and Jeté & Jerry, a sparkling wine and oyster pairing hosted by Jerry Fraser and Gerome Vaughan.

Long lunches feature throughout the weekend, with options ranging from a Spanish-style Basque Long Table at Lum’s to a multi-region European Long Lunch at The Unicorn Bar and a French-focused Champagne, Chardonnay et Charcuterie at La Bastide. Those wanting to explore at their own pace can opt for the Subi Culinary Crawl or the Vino & Cichetti bar hop, inspired by Venetian bacari.

Aperitivo sessions return with Juanita’s and Friends: Aperitivo Club, bringing together drinks, bites and DJ sets, while Mistelle Bistro will host L’Apéro du Quartier, a French-style apéro hour built around sharing boards and spritzes.

The final day includes the Euro Sunday Sesh, a collaboration between chefs Ben Ing and Ben Jacob, pairing West Australian produce with Italian flavours alongside Cherubino Wines and FOUND brews.

Beyond food and drink, the program also includes a street art tour, a free family screening of the Italian film “The War of the Nonni” and the return of The Kiosk, which will transform Forrest Walk into an Italian-style piazza with a pop-up spritz bar and Italo disco DJs.

Now in its fifth year, Subi Spritz has become a regular fixture on the Subiaco calendar, drawing crowds for a festival that blends food, wine and European-inspired culture across the neighbourhood.

City of Subiaco Mayor David McMullen said, “Subi Spritz is our iconic event showcasing our very own food and beverage experiences to the whole of Perth. We are delighted to see so many Subiaco businesses take part in this year’s festival and hope Perth foodies will come out and explore, taste and see Subiaco.”
